Inclusion criteria

Inclusion criteria: Age older than 18 years requires increased attached gingiva width in the mandibular premolar area(Keratinized gingiva less than 2mm or attached gingiva less than 1mm) Patients' health in terms of systemic and periodontal conditions (probe depth less than 3 mm or BOP Grade 1 or less) good plaque control (plaque index less than 20%) Ability to adapt the patient to the study-related processes

Exclusion criteria

Exclusion criteria: 1- heavy smoker (those who smokes more than 10 cigarettes a day) Having a systemic problem that has a negative effect on wound healing. And taking medications that interfere with surgical repair pregnant patients Use of antibiotics over the past 6 months

Design outcomes

Primary

MeasureTime frame
Dimensional changes of free gingival grafts in two substrates prepared with Orbium Laser Er: Cr: YSGG and the Scalpel Common Method. Timepoint: 1st, 3rd and 6th months after surgery. Method of measurement: Image J software (mm2).

Secondary

MeasureTime frame
Duration of surgery. Timepoint: Surgical day. Method of measurement: Time in minutes.;Pain. Timepoint: The first 10 days after surgery. Method of measurement: Questionaire (VAS).;Swelling. Timepoint: The first 10 days after surgery. Method of measurement: questionnaire and patient examination.;Hematoma. Timepoint: the first 10 days after surgery. Method of measurement: questionaire.;Colour Match (brightness parameters). Timepoint: 6 month after surgery. Method of measurement: adobe photoshop.
